Description
In the uncharted depths of the galaxy, an ancient warlike race known as the Kreel finds themselves on the brink of a groundbreaking discovery. Their primitive society, previously focused solely on conflict and survival, suddenly encounters something extraordinary that challenges everything they think they know. This unexpected revelation shifts the balance of power and threatens to unsettle their violent way of life.
As the Kreel grapple with their newfound knowledge, they are drawn into a complex web of alliances and rivalries. The inhabitants of the galaxy are immediately aware of the potential consequences of the Kreel's discovery, leading to a tense standoff among various factions eager to bend the situation to their advantage. The struggle is not just for control but for the very future of their civilizations.
Amidst this chaos, unexpected heroes and tragic figures emerge, each navigating the perilous landscape filled with betrayal, ambition, and the relentless pursuit of power. Friendships will be tested, and loyalties challenged as the true nature of the Kreel’s discovery unfolds. The stakes are higher than ever as the line between ally and enemy becomes increasingly blurred.
As the conflict escalates, the galaxy holds its breath, waiting to see who will prevail and what the Kreel's discovery will mean for their fate and the fate of all civilizations involved. The narrative weaves a tale of adventure, intrigue, and reflection on the nature of progress and the costs that accompany it.
